What is a BG3 Build Calculator?
A bg3 build calculator is an essential tool for players of Baldur’s Gate 3 who want to optimize their character’s performance in combat. It allows you to input various character statistics—such as ability scores, level, and equipment details—to simulate and predict outcomes like damage output, survivability, and effectiveness of abilities. By using a bg3 build calculator, players can experiment with different character configurations without having to commit hours of gameplay to test a new idea. This is crucial for planning a character’s progression from level 1 to 12.
This type of calculator is designed for theorycrafters and min-maxers who enjoy understanding the mechanics of the D&D 5e ruleset that Baldur’s Gate 3 is based on. Whether you’re trying to build the ultimate damage-dealer, an unkillable tank, or a versatile support character, a calculator provides the hard data needed to make informed decisions. It takes the guesswork out of character creation and helps you achieve your desired build goals more efficiently.

BG3 Damage Formula and Mathematical Explanation
The core of any damage-focused bg3 build calculator is the formula for calculating Damage Per Round (DPR). DPR is a metric used to measure a character’s average damage output over time, accounting for both their damage per hit and their accuracy. Understanding this formula is key to build optimization.
The primary calculation is as follows:
DPR = (Average Weapon Damage + Ability Modifier + Bonus Damage) * Number of Attacks * Chance to Hit
Step-by-Step Derivation
- Calculate Ability Modifier: This is derived from your primary ability score (Strength or Dexterity for most weapon attacks). The formula is
floor((Ability Score - 10) / 2). - Calculate Proficiency Bonus: This bonus is based on your character level. It’s +2 for levels 1-4, +3 for levels 5-8, and +4 for levels 9-12.
- Calculate Attack Bonus: This is the total bonus you add to your d20 roll to hit an enemy. The formula is
Ability Modifier + Proficiency Bonus. - Calculate Chance to Hit: This is your probability of successfully landing an attack. It’s calculated as
(21 - (Enemy AC - Attack Bonus)) / 20. This result is a percentage, capped at 95% (a roll of 20 always hits) and floored at 5% (a roll of 1 always misses). - Calculate Average Damage Per Hit: This is the sum of your average weapon damage (e.g., 1d8 is 4.5), your ability modifier, and any other flat bonuses.
- Calculate Final DPR: Multiply the average damage per hit by your number of attacks per round, and then multiply that total by your chance to hit. This gives you a realistic, averaged damage output. For help with spells, you might consult a d&d 5e damage calculator.
Variables Table
| Variable | Meaning | Unit | Typical Range |
|---|---|---|---|
| Ability Score | Your character’s raw Strength, Dexterity, etc. | Points | 8 – 24 |
| Ability Modifier | The bonus derived from an Ability Score. | Modifier | -1 to +7 |
| Proficiency Bonus | A bonus based on character level for actions you’re trained in. | Modifier | +2 to +4 |
| Enemy AC | The target’s Armor Class, which you must beat to hit. | Points | 10 – 25 |
| Avg. Weapon Damage | The average roll of your weapon’s damage dice. | Damage | 2.5 (1d4) to 7 (1d12) |
Practical Examples (Real-World Use Cases)
Example 1: Level 5 Two-Handed Fighter
A classic Great Weapon Master build. This example demonstrates the high-risk, high-reward nature of this popular fighting style. It’s a cornerstone build discussed in many guides on the best bg3 builds.
- Inputs: Level 5, 18 Strength, 2 Attacks, Greatsword (2d6), +10 bonus damage (from Great Weapon Master feat), attacking an enemy with 16 AC.
- Calculation:
- Ability Modifier: +4 (from 18 Str)
- Proficiency Bonus: +3 (at Level 5)
- Attack Bonus: +4 (Str) + 3 (Prof) – 5 (GWM Feat) = +2
- Chance to Hit: ((21 – (16 – 2)) / 20) = 35%
- Avg. Damage Per Hit: 7 (2d6) + 4 (Str) + 10 (GWM) = 21
- Output (DPR): 21 (Avg Dmg) * 2 (Attacks) * 0.35 (Hit Chance) = 14.7 DPR
- Interpretation: While the damage per hit is massive, the accuracy penalty from Great Weapon Master significantly reduces the effective DPR against a well-armored foe. This is a trade-off every user of a bg3 build calculator must consider.
Example 2: Level 9 Dual-Wielding Rogue
This example showcases a high-dexterity build focused on multiple, accurate strikes enhanced by Sneak Attack.
- Inputs: Level 9, 20 Dexterity, 3 Attacks (Main, Off-hand, Bonus Action), Shortsword (1d6), 5d6 Sneak Attack bonus, attacking an enemy with 17 AC.
- Calculation (Main Hand):
- Ability Modifier: +5 (from 20 Dex)
- Proficiency Bonus: +4 (at Level 9)
- Attack Bonus: +5 (Dex) + 4 (Prof) = +9
- Chance to Hit: ((21 – (17 – 9)) / 20) = 65%
- Avg. Damage Per Hit (with Sneak Attack): 3.5 (1d6) + 17.5 (5d6) + 5 (Dex) = 26
- Main Hand DPR: 26 (Avg Dmg) * 1 (Attack) * 0.65 (Hit Chance) = 16.9 DPR
- Calculation (Off-Hand):
- Avg. Damage Per Hit (no ability mod without fighting style): 3.5 (1d6)
- Off-Hand DPR: 3.5 (Avg Dmg) * 2 (Attacks) * 0.65 (Hit Chance) = 4.55 DPR
- Interpretation: The total DPR is approximately 21.45. The high accuracy and consistent Sneak Attack damage make this a very reliable build. A bg3 build calculator shows how Sneak Attack provides a massive portion of the total damage.

Key Factors That Affect BG3 Results
Your damage output in Baldur’s Gate 3 is influenced by numerous factors. A good bg3 build calculator helps you balance them. Here are the most critical ones:
- Ability Scores: Your primary attack stat (Strength or Dexterity) is fundamental. It affects both your chance to hit and your damage per hit.
- Proficiency Bonus: This scales with your level and increases your accuracy, making higher-level characters more reliable.
- Weapon Choice: The base damage dice of your weapon (e.g., d6 vs. d12) sets the foundation for your damage output. A better weapon can be a huge upgrade, so keep an eye on patch notes for weapon changes.
- Feats: Game-changing feats like Great Weapon Master or Sharpshooter offer a massive damage boost at the cost of accuracy. A bg3 build calculator is perfect for seeing when this trade-off is worth it.
- Buffs and Debuffs: Spells like Bless (improves accuracy) or Hex (adds damage) can dramatically alter your DPR. External factors are a key part of any advanced baldurs gate 3 character planner.
- Enemy Defenses: A high Armor Class (AC) can render a powerful but inaccurate build ineffective. Targeting enemies with lower AC is a valid strategy.
Frequently Asked Questions (FAQ)
- 1. Does this calculator account for Advantage or Disadvantage?
- No, this particular bg3 build calculator assumes a straight roll. Advantage and Disadvantage significantly alter hit probabilities, effectively acting as a large bonus or penalty to your roll.
- 2. How is critical hit damage calculated?
- This calculator focuses on average, non-critical damage. A critical hit (usually on a natural 20 roll) doubles all your damage dice. While not included here for simplicity, it adds roughly 5% to your total damage output.
- 3. Why is my in-game damage different?
- Baldur’s Gate 3 involves randomness (dice rolls). This calculator provides the statistical average over many rounds. In any single round, your actual damage will vary. It also doesn’t account for specific enemy resistances or vulnerabilities.
- 4. Can I use this for spell damage?
- This calculator is optimized for weapon attacks. Spell damage calculations are different, often involving saving throws instead of AC. You would need a specialized bg3 build calculator for spells.
- 5. How important is the number of attacks?
- Extremely. As the DPR formula shows, the number of attacks is a direct multiplier on your damage. Classes that get extra attacks (like Fighter) or can attack with a bonus action (using two-weapon fighting or certain feats) have a high DPR ceiling.
- 6. Is higher DPR always better?
- Not necessarily. High DPR is great, but a character also needs survivability (HP, AC) and utility (control spells, support abilities). A “glass cannon” build with high DPR but low health may not be effective in challenging fights.
- 7. How do I factor in temporary magical effects?
- You can add damage from effects like Hunter’s Mark or a Paladin’s Smite into the “Bonus Damage” field. For accuracy bonuses like Bless, you would need to manually adjust your Attack Bonus before seeing the final effect on this calculator.
- 8. What’s a good benchmark for DPR at level 5?
- A well-optimized, damage-focused character at level 5 can often achieve a DPR of 15-25 against a typical enemy. However, this varies greatly based on class, gear, and the specific enemy being fought. Using a bg3 build calculator is the best way to find out for your specific character.
